The MELARQT SHASHIBO is a premium, award-winning magnetic puzzle box featuring 36 rare earth magnets that transform into over 100 unique shapes. Crafted from recycled ABS plastic with tear-resistant, vibrant artwork, it offers a tactile, sensory-rich experience that enhances creativity, spatial skills, and stress relief. Designed for ages 8 and up, it supports STEM/STEAM learning and encourages collecting multiple cubes to build larger magnetic sculptures.

Fascinating, Slightly Confusing… and Now I Want One
I bought the Shashibo Shape Shifting Box for my nephew, thinking it would be a quick distraction toy. What I didn’t expect was to spend a solid 20 minutes trying to figure it out myself while he patiently explained how it works. This thing is surprisingly addictive. It transforms into loads of different shapes, and once you get the hang of it, it’s genuinely satisfying to flip and fold into new designs. My nephew took to it quickly and now carries it around like some kind of pocket-sized puzzle wizard. The magnets feel strong and the construction is sturdy enough to survive enthusiastic hands. It’s compact, doesn’t require batteries (a huge win), and actually encourages problem-solving rather than just flashing lights and noise. That said, there is a slight learning curve. I definitely needed a moment (or several) to understand how to create the more complex shapes. There may have been some “I meant to do that” moments. Pros: ✔ Genuinely engaging and interactive ✔ Encourages creativity and problem-solving ✔ Strong magnets and solid build ✔ Compact and easy to carry ✔ No batteries required (parents rejoice) Cons: ✖ Slight learning curve at first ✖ May result in adults “borrowing” it Overall, this was a great gift choice. It kept my nephew entertained — and briefly humbled his uncle. A fun and slightly brain-twisting 4-star toy that’s much more interesting than it first appears.

Favourite most played with gift Christmas 2024
I actually watched a video that the creator of these cubes had shared online, as an autistic Mother of two autistic teens who are both very creative, very visual and constantly stimming - this was the best stim / fidget toy I've ever bought for my kids hands down. Having learned the hard way in the past, (I now buy the more expensive brand as cheap Chinese versions are far more likely to break/ fall apart) I was immediately delighted with my decision to buy the creators more expensive model - this feels solid, it's high quality, incredibly well made and will clearly be a permanent fixture in my home ! Since opening on Christmas morning, I haven't once seen my kids reach for objects that are not the safest to stim with (I can't be the only Mum of autistic teens who frequently finds hob lighters, tools and random objects wherever they are!) Their cubes have been permanently by their sides since opening and they are so relaxed, happy and clearly enjoying the sensory input that these genius toys provide! I do think these are better for older kids, teenagers and adults - I suspect younger kids would struggle with opening the cube and in creating the different shapes. For any parents considering purchasing this for your autistic child - but put off by the cost - I have spent the same on a large set of fidget spinners that were touched once then barely used again. This is the best money I've spent this Christmas and I'm tempted to buy more to keep around the house ( so my hob lighters stay at my hub)

Overpriced. Fun for a very short period of time. Maybe ok for very young children.
I must admit I was very excited about this cube. I bought two of them! I believed the hype and positive reviews. I ended up given them as a present to a 6 year old child. She will start learning geometry and math soon and I thought she might benefit from these toys. The material used is kind of cardboard/paper and like other people have mentioned the longevity of these toys can’t be very long. The quality of printing and design/patterns used are ok, nothing especial or beautiful about them. Fast delivery that’s true. About the puzzles/shapes: the magnets are strong and I can understand why people love playing with them, it’s oddly satisfying. Feels good to manipulate. Level of difficulty? Well, I am honest and describe only my own experience: Low. I am average I think. But these cubes and basic shapes and more you can achieve them intuitively in less than 30 min and I am kind of exaggerating and being generous… 10-15 minutes is all you need. Return it to the original cube shape is really EASY and straight forward too. Yes you could collect them and make more shapes… but is it worthy? I am not sure, too expensive for a very limited toy. I don’t even consider these puzzles to be completely honest. I love my Rubik cubes and never get tired of them, I love some more than others of course. And I have invested in good ones too. That’s far more fun and would recommend Rubik over this cube. Trust me I was excited about the 3D cube… such a shame! EDIT: I am delighted… I can’t believe how successful these toys are among children. I will buy it again for other kids. After observing how different children play with them I can confirm the size and the materials used are more than adequate. Difficulty level is also perfect for children, this cube invites them to try and generate geometrical shapes easily, it ignites their imagination that’s for sure! They can compete with each other, they can collect them, they can learn and study the different shapes. I am really impressed. I would say kids 5-10 years old would be fascinated by these cubes and they will feel they can achieve these little goals. Not bad after all. Still these toys are very overpriced for what they are… but we all know how pricing works, once this trend/marketing starts to disappear they will have to lower the price. It’s ridiculous… as a consumer it really annoys me.
